![JAR search and dependency download from the Maven repository](/logo.png)
org.bonitasoft.engine.bdm.model.BusinessObjectModel.class Maven / Gradle / Ivy
Go to download
Show more of this group Show more artifacts with this name
Show all versions of bonita-business-object-model Show documentation
Show all versions of bonita-business-object-model Show documentation
This module defines the Bonita Business Object Model.
The newest version!
???? 7 ?
java/lang/Object ()V java/util/ArrayList
3org/bonitasoft/engine/bdm/model/BusinessObjectModel businessObjects Ljava/util/List; modelVersion Ljava/lang/String; productVersion java/util/List add (Ljava/lang/Object;)Z java/util/HashSet
! " # iterator ()Ljava/util/Iterator; % & ' ( ) java/util/Iterator hasNext ()Z % + , - next ()Ljava/lang/Object; / .org/bonitasoft/engine/bdm/model/BusinessObject
. 1 2 3 getQualifiedName ()Ljava/lang/String;
. 6 7 8 )getReferencedBusinessObjectsByComposition ()Ljava/util/List; : ; < addAll (Ljava/util/Collection;)Z
. > ? 8 getUniqueConstraints
. A B 8
getIndexes
D E F getClass ()Ljava/lang/Class;
H I J K L java/util/Objects equals '(Ljava/lang/Object;Ljava/lang/Object;)Z
H N O P hash ([Ljava/lang/Object;)I R java/util/StringJoiner T ,
V W X Y 3 java/lang/Class
getSimpleName [ \ ] makeConcatWithConstants &(Ljava/lang/String;)Ljava/lang/String; _ ]
Q a b K(Ljava/lang/CharSequence;Ljava/lang/CharSequence;Ljava/lang/CharSequence;)V d \ e $(Ljava/util/List;)Ljava/lang/String;
Q g h 2(Ljava/lang/CharSequence;)Ljava/util/StringJoiner;
Q j k 3 toString CURRENT_MODEL_VERSION
ConstantValue o 1.0 Signature BLjava/util/List; RuntimeVisibleAnnotations -Ljavax/xml/bind/annotation/XmlElementWrapper; name required &Ljavax/xml/bind/annotation/XmlElement; businessObject (Ljavax/xml/bind/annotation/XmlAttribute; Code LineNumberTable LocalVariableTable this 5Lorg/bonitasoft/engine/bdm/model/BusinessObjectModel; setModelVersion (Ljava/lang/String;)V getModelVersion setProductVersion getProductVersion getBusinessObjects D()Ljava/util/List; setBusinessObjects (Ljava/util/List;)V LocalVariableTypeTable E(Ljava/util/List;)V addBusinessObject 3(Lorg/bonitasoft/engine/bdm/model/BusinessObject;)V 0Lorg/bonitasoft/engine/bdm/model/BusinessObject; getBusinessObjectsClassNames ()Ljava/util/Set; o set Ljava/util/HashSet; 'Ljava/util/HashSet;
StackMapTable %()Ljava/util/Set; bo refs constraints DLjava/util/List; F()Ljava/util/List; indexes 9Ljava/util/List; ;()Ljava/util/List; Ljava/lang/Object; that hashCode ()I
SourceFile BusinessObjectModel.java *Ljavax/xml/bind/annotation/XmlRootElement; +Ljavax/xml/bind/annotation/XmlAccessorType; value )Ljavax/xml/bind/annotation/XmlAccessType; FIELD BootstrapMethods ?
? ? ? \ ? $java/lang/invoke/StringConcatFactory ?(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/String;[Ljava/lang/Object;)Ljava/lang/invoke/CallSite; ? [ ? businessObjects= InnerClasses ? %java/lang/invoke/MethodHandles$Lookup ? java/lang/invoke/MethodHandles Lookup ! l m n p q r s ts uZ v w ts x uZ v r y ts uZ z r y ts uZ z { B *? *? Y? ?
? | 1 2 3 } ~ ? ? { > *+? ? |
6 7 } ~ ? 3 { / *? ? | : } ~ ? ? { > *+? ? |
> ? } ~ ? 3 { / *? ? | B } ~ ? 8 { / *?
? | F } ~ p ? ? ? { P *+?
? |
J K } ~ ? q p ? ? ? { D *?
+? W? |
N O } ~ x ? ? ? { ? 3? Y? L*?
? M,? $ ? ,? * ? .N+-? 0? 4W???+? | R S % T . U 1 V } % ? ? 3 ~ + ? ? ? + ? ? ? ? %? p ? 7 8 { ? 5? Y? L*?
? M,? $ ? ,? * ? .N+-? 5? 9 W???+? | Z [ % \ 0 ] 3 ^ } % ? ? 5 ~ - ? ? - ? q ? ? %? p ? ? 8 { ? 5? Y? L*?
? M,? $ ? ,? * ? .N+-? =? 9 W???+? | b c % d 0 e 3 f } % ? ? 5 ~ - ? ? - ? ? ? ? %? p ? B 8 { ? 5? Y? L*?
? M,? $ ? ,? * ? .N+-? @? 9 W???+? | j k % l 0 m 3 n } % ? ? 5 ~ - ? ? - ? ? ? ? %? p ? K { ? M*+? ?+? *? C+? C? ?+? M*?
,?
? G? #*? ,? ? G? *? ,? ? G? ? ? | " s t u v w x A y L x } M ~ M ? ? 0 ? ?
? 2 @ ? ? { G ? Y*?
SY*? SY*? S? M? | ~ } ~ k 3 { [ %? QYS? U? Z ^? `*?
? c ? f? i? | ? ? ! ? $ ? } % ~ ? ? r ? ? ?e ? ? ? ? ? ? ? ?
? ? ?
© 2015 - 2025 Weber Informatics LLC | Privacy Policy